Hampden Park Stadium, Glasgow.

SV captains tossing. SV crowd. GV game under way. SV Aberdeen attacking. Goal keeper Brown picks up an easy one and clears up field. GV midfield play... Aberdeen collect and swing play towards rangers goal. Lead to goal. SV O'Neil shoots and scores. SV players...
